Happy 150th Canada! You don't look a year over 125.

Quote: Canada 150 website

Celebrate Canada is a four-day celebration that begins on June 21 with National Aboriginal Day, continues with Saint-Jean-Baptiste Day (June 24) and Canadian Multiculturalism Day (June 27), and comes to a spectacular finish on Canada Day (July 1).

I thought I knew the meaning of the prefix 'sesqui' from the evidence - but I was wrong [altho 150th is correct for sesquicentennial]

Wizard should use it for one of his quizzes? slightly math-connected.

The prefix sesqui- is a shortened form of a Latin word meaning “a half in addition” or 1½ times; it appears in the rather better known sesquicentennial for a 150th anniversary. So semisesquicentennial refers to half of 1½ of 100 or 75. .... https://www.google.com/#q=sesqui+prefix+meaning[/spoiler]
